公開:

SSH(Secure Shell)とは?意味をわかりやすく簡単に解説

text: XEXEQ編集部


SSH(Secure Shell)とは

SSHはSecure Shellの略称で、ネットワーク上でデータを安全に通信するためのプロトコルです。SSHは、クライアントとサーバー間の通信を暗号化し、データの盗聴や改ざんを防ぐことができます。

SSHは、リモートログイン、コマンド実行、ファイル転送など、様々な用途で使用されています。SSHを使用することで、インターネット上で安全にサーバーを管理したり、ファイルを転送したりすることが可能となります。

SSHは、公開鍵暗号方式を使用しています。クライアントとサーバーは、それぞれ公開鍵と秘密鍵のペアを持ち、通信の際に公開鍵を交換します。これにより、第三者が通信内容を盗聴しても、復号化することができないため、安全性が高いのが特徴です。

SSHは、ポート番号22番を使用するのが一般的ですが、セキュリティ上の理由から、ポート番号を変更することもあります。また、SSHには、SSH1とSSH2の2つのバージョンがあり、現在はSSH2が主流となっています。

SSHは、LinuxmacOSなどのUNIX系OSで標準的に使用されていますが、Windowsでも、SSHクライアントソフトウェアを使用することで、SSHを利用可能です。SSHは、ネットワーク管理者にとって必須のツールの一つと言えるでしょう。

※上記コンテンツはAIで確認しておりますが、間違い等ある場合はコメントよりご連絡いただけますと幸いです。

「セキュリティ」に関するコラム一覧「セキュリティ」に関するニュース一覧
ブログに戻る

コメントを残す

コメントは公開前に承認される必要があることにご注意ください。